The Boxster is the entry-level Porsche, right? Not this one. Welcome to the 493bhp, 9,000rpm world of the 718 Spyder RS – the last hurrah for petrol-powered mid-engined Porsches before the next Boxster goes all electric.



And what a way to go out swinging: Porsche’s dumped as many GT4 RS components as it can into its two-seat roadster: the howling naturally aspirated engine, lighter panels, more aero and then it set about redesigning the roof, to make it lighter. And much harder to erect in a hurry…



There’s also lower (but less hardcore) suspension, optional magnesium wheels, and no manual gearbox. Flappy paddles only here – but is that enough to put you off spending your £123,000 on the most badass Boxster ever?
